== i@nseo: what’s that? ==&lt;br /&gt;
i@nseo is a software for managing archery tournaments results, created as Open Source program, thanks to the initial support of the Italian Archery Federation ([https://fitarco.it Fitarco]). The Italian Federation then promoted its use to European Countries first, and a few months later i@nseo was used all around the world. After being translated into several languages (more than 30, though its user interface was originally created in Italian), i@nseo has become the world most bleeding edge software for managing archery competitions, the only one that embeds all the rules from World Archery (WA). It constantly evolves, not only to fulfill the new WA requirements, but also to meet the needs of all its stakeholders, from the most important Federations to common users.&lt;/div&gt;</summary>
